WebFeb 10, 2015 · Motherland and Fatherland first appeared in the "American Dictionary of the English Language" in 1847. Motherland was defined as "the land of one's mother or parents," and fatherland as "the ... WebVolksgemeinschaft, (German: “people’s community”) in Nazi Germany, a racially unified and hierarchically organized body in which the interests of individuals would be strictly subordinate to those of the nation, or Volk. Like a military battalion, the people’s community would be permanently prepared for war and would accept the discipline that this required.
